Bosnia and Herzegovina 1992 Coat of Arms Shot Glass

This shot glass showcases the first official coat of arms of the Republic of Bosnia and Herzegovina, a powerful visual statement of independence adopted in 1992. The design is a bold and striking representation of Bosnian history and identity.

The Design Elements

The central element is a shield, rendered in a vibrant blue (azure) background. This provides a striking contrast and foundation for the heraldic symbols that follow.

A prominent white diagonal band (bend) elegantly bisects the shield, flowing from the upper left to the lower right. This establishes a dynamic visual flow, drawing the eye across the design.

Arranged along the white diagonal are six golden fleurs-de-lis, meticulously depicted. These stylized lily-like flowers are a direct reference to the medieval Bosnian royal emblem, specifically the arms of the Kotromanić dynasty, symbolizing the historical continuity and the nation's regal past.

Symbolism and Meaning

The design, as a whole, is deeply symbolic. The azure background often represents truth and loyalty. The bend adds a sense of movement and direction. The fleurs-de-lis, in their placement, honor the medieval roots of the Bosnian nation. This combination of elements speaks volumes about Bosnia and Herzegovina’s sovereignty and the enduring strength of its national identity.
